• XSS.stack #1 – первый литературный журнал от юзеров форума

Сабж "заменит ли ИИ программистов" ?

Кстати да . Психологически с нейронкой общаться проще, чем с людьми. Хз почему.

Может быть поэтому? :D

1676526690130180788.jpg
 
Пожалуйста, обратите внимание, что пользователь заблокирован
"Разработка систем поиска уязвимостей в программном коде с применением технологий машинного обучения"
Учитывая что стц занимается разработкой малвари Монокль, весьма любопытное направление деятельности.
 
Нйеронки для кодеров будут предоставлять концепты, подобно тому как они сейчас художникам делают концепт арты. Получить на сформулированную задачу наброски архитектур и псевдокоды будет очень хорошим подспорьем. А еще нейронки дадут очень хорший анализ кода в процессе его написания, тесты нейронка сможет, оптимизацию пайплайна. Тут кодеру важно не побеждать а возглавлять.
 
Нйеронки для кодеров будут предоставлять концепты, подобно тому как они сейчас художникам делают концепт арты. Получить на сформулированную задачу наброски архитектур и псевдокоды будет очень хорошим подспорьем. А еще нейронки дадут очень хорший анализ кода в процессе его написания, тесты нейронка сможет, оптимизацию пайплайна. Тут кодеру важно не побеждать а возглавлять.
Мне кажется, что тренд с нейронками замечательный. Еще лучше, чем с открытыми фреймворками. Быдло сейчас начнет генерировать бажный код в несусветных количествах и вкусного_везде_доступного станет еще больше. Особенно, если бажный код будет где-то наверху - для хорошей такой supply chain attack.

Хули, живем при капитализме - доступная каждому Васе нейронка - будет делать любую разработку хуерги еще дешевле, чем эффективные_менеджеры будут с охотой пользоваться. Пострадает от этого как всегда - простой люд - кодеры-середнячки, начинающие и мелкие проекты-сайты типа ветеринарных клиник, которые неожиданно обнаружат себя в ботнетах как бэкконнект-прокси для веселых вещей, либо жс-сниффер на форме заказа, что снимет 30 картонок для Пети из Дичанки.

С высокооплачиваемыми кодерами - ничего не случится, для них работа будет всегда (как минимум - чтобы разгребать последствия этого говнокодинга с нейронок). Индусов не жалко, достаточно работы криворукие пидорасы украли у украинцев и русских, эффективных менеджеров тоже не жалко :)
 
Вспомните кочегаров, фонарщиков, телефонисток... вспомнили? Вы ответили на свой вопрос. :)
 
Мне кажется, что тренд с нейронками замечательный. Еще лучше, чем с открытыми фреймворками. Быдло сейчас начнет генерировать бажный код в несусветных количествах и вкусного_везде_доступного станет еще больше. Особенно, если бажный код будет где-то наверху - для хорошей такой supply chain attack.

Хули, живем при капитализме - доступная каждому Васе нейронка - будет делать любую разработку хуерги еще дешевле, чем эффективные_менеджеры будут с охотой пользоваться. Пострадает от этого как всегда - простой люд - кодеры-середнячки, начинающие и мелкие проекты-сайты типа ветеринарных клиник, которые неожиданно обнаружат себя в ботнетах как бэкконнект-прокси для веселых вещей, либо жс-сниффер на форме заказа, что снимет 30 картонок для Пети из Дичанки.

С высокооплачиваемыми кодерами - ничего не случится, для них работа будет всегда (как минимум - чтобы разгребать последствия этого говнокодинга с нейронок). Индусов не жалко, достаточно работы криворукие пидорасы украли у украинцев и русских, эффективных менеджеров тоже не жалко :)
Вы невнимательно читали. От нейронки нужны будут наборы концептов а не готовый код, а уязвимостей будет как раз намного меньше, многие будут находится еще до запуска тестов, а сквозь тесты будут просчаиваться уже совсем крохи. Уже сейчас иде неплохо анализируют код в процессе его написания, а с нейронкой будет будет еще лучше, она ошибок по невнимательности и лени допускать не будет, более того когда еще хорошо натаскают на детект уязвимостей в уже готовых кодах, то с бажными фреймвоками будет сложно. Основная проблема человеков они мысленно не способны глубоко в рекурсию, то есть мысленно пркрутить движение данных и переключение веток в глубь на несколько методов или даже сервисов им трудно, а для нейронки это не проблема, со всеми отсюда вытекающими. Итак мой вывод что нейронки это предложение наиболее подходящих архитектур(юмлки, предложения по наиболее подходящим фреймам, предложения по декомпозициям(от лееров до классов), псевдокод) и контроль качества а не готовый к релизу код.
 
Вы невнимательно читали. От нейронки нужны будут наборы концептов а не готовый код, а уязвимостей будет как раз намного меньше, многие будут находится еще до запуска тестов, а сквозь тесты будут просчаиваться уже совсем крохи. Уже сейчас иде неплохо анализируют код в процессе его написания, а с нейронкой будет будет еще лучше, она ошибок по невнимательности и лени допускать не будет, более того когда еще хорошо натаскают на детект уязвимостей в уже готовых кодах, то с бажными фреймвоками будет сложно. Основная проблема человеков они мысленно не способны глубоко в рекурсию, то есть мысленно пркрутить движение данных и переключение веток в глубь на несколько методов или даже сервисов им трудно, а для нейронки это не проблема, со всеми отсюда вытекающими. Итак мой вывод что нейронки это предложение наиболее подходящих архитектур(юмлки, предложения по наиболее подходящим фреймам, предложения по декомпозициям(от лееров до классов), псевдокод) и контроль качества а не готовый к релизу код.

Теория всегда звучит сладко, но на практике я вижу, к чему привело широкое использование опенсорс js-библиотек в веб-проектах. Все нахуй пихают кучу ссылок на внешние репозитарии даже не задумываясь, насколько они теперь контроллируют свой собственный проект и что представляет из себя код ("сообщество найдет баги, это безопаснее", ну-ну, блядь, конечно найдет, когда 99% сообщества такие же быдлокодеры как и ты сам).

Вот сейчас уже профессионалы_нашей_профессии (толстая ирония) пробуют хуярить малвару через ChatGPT api, посмотрим к чему это приведет :) Возможно я заблуждаюсь, но опыт подсказывает, что пресловутый "человеческий фактор" - не такой большой риск, как бездумный эникей с полуавтоматическими-автоматическими действиями. Я сторонник старой школы, когда ты осознаешь, что ты делаешь, с чем ты работаешь и как все работает вокруг тебя. Это как с мотоциклом - я обслуживаю его сам, а куча товарищей по байк клубу тупо хуярят к механику ("он знает лучше"). Я думаю все те же самые люди побежали бы к нейронке обслуживать свою механику с пребольшой радостью :) Гуманитарии маст_дай.
 
Теория всегда звучит сладко, но на практике я вижу, к чему привело широкое использование опенсорс js-библиотек в веб-проектах. Все нахуй пихают кучу ссылок на внешние репозитарии даже не задумываясь, насколько они теперь контроллируют свой собственный проект и что представляет из себя код ("сообщество найдет баги, это безопаснее", ну-ну, блядь, конечно найдет, когда 99% сообщества такие же быдлокодеры как и ты сам).

Вот сейчас уже профессионалы_нашей_профессии (толстая ирония) пробуют хуярить малвару через ChatGPT api, посмотрим к чему это приведет :) Возможно я заблуждаюсь, но опыт подсказывает, что пресловутый "человеческий фактор" - не такой большой риск, как бездумный эникей с полуавтоматическими-автоматическими действиями. Я сторонник старой школы, когда ты осознаешь, что ты делаешь, с чем ты работаешь и как все работает вокруг тебя. Это как с мотоциклом - я обслуживаю его сам, а куча товарищей по байк клубу тупо хуярят к механику ("он знает лучше"). Я думаю все те же самые люди побежали бы к нейронке обслуживать свою механику с пребольшой радостью :) Гуманитарии маст_дай.
Ну так я и пишу что будут годные концепты и тесты от нейроки а не код.
Смотрите нейронки не могут ответить красивая картина или нет, но могут ответить насколько гармоничны цевета в ней, насколько правельные формы. Так и по _архитектуре_ кода они могут подсказать наиболее гармоничные пути, и так же по тестам способны найти большинсво моментов где проебан контроль над входящими или исходящими данными, а уязвимости это как раз такой проебанный контроль. Мне как кодеру очевидны эти моменты. Мне вот инетесно что будет в военной сфере, потому что ии управляющий дронами это будет пиздец, он не устает, не промахивается, не отвлекается, не сомневается, и это будет настолько дешевле живого бойца что тот кто первый построит эффективный ии в этой сфере тот и унаследует землю. Признавайся сколько принял на грудь?
 
потому что ии управляющий дронами это будет пиздец, он не устает, не промахивается, не отвлекается, не сомневается, и это будет настолько дешевле живого бойца что тот кто первый построит эффективный ии в этой сфере тот и унаследует землю. Признавайся сколько принял на грудь?

Предложи полковнику дополнить ТЗ, лол:

Проект 10Разработка системы идентификации беспилотных летательных аппаратов (БЛА, дронов) различных производителей, использующих для управления и передачи данных радиоинтерфейс ieee 802. 11 (wifi)В результате выполнения должен быть разработан программный продукт, который принимает на вход запись радиосигнала, выполняет ее анализ и по итогам классифицирует (маркирует ее) одним из исходов:
• данные не содержат признаков передачи дронов;
• данные, вероятно, содержат передачу дрона или пульта управления, но конкретные параметры неизвестны;
• данные содержат передачу дрона и/или пульта, известна конкретная модель дрона или протокола
Wireshark – для исследования сигналов, C/C++ и/или Python – для реализации продукта. Возможно использование методов машинного обучения для построения классификатора - на усмотрение разработчика.
 
Что то мне подсказывает что этот полковник про ии даже пугался. Ах а какая координация у них будет, вот это будет что назвается рой.
 
Мне кажется, что тренд с нейронками замечательный. Еще лучше, чем с открытыми фреймворками. Быдло сейчас начнет генерировать бажный код в несусветных количествах и вкусного_везде_доступного станет еще больше. Особенно, если бажный код будет где-то наверху - для хорошей такой supply chain attack.

Хули, живем при капитализме - доступная каждому Васе нейронка - будет делать любую разработку хуерги еще дешевле, чем эффективные_менеджеры будут с охотой пользоваться. Пострадает от этого как всегда - простой люд - кодеры-середнячки, начинающие и мелкие проекты-сайты типа ветеринарных клиник, которые неожиданно обнаружат себя в ботнетах как бэкконнект-прокси для веселых вещей, либо жс-сниффер на форме заказа, что снимет 30 картонок для Пети из Дичанки.

С высокооплачиваемыми кодерами - ничего не случится, для них работа будет всегда (как минимум - чтобы разгребать последствия этого говнокодинга с нейронок). Индусов не жалко, достаточно работы криворукие пидорасы украли у украинцев и русских, эффективных менеджеров тоже не жалко :)
Нейронке не проблема сгенерирвать под каждый новый проект измененный или совсем новый язык или вообще программировать на ассамблере. Как в этом можно искать уязвимости? А если это будет что то вроде wasm? Да еще и под асинхронным шифрованием.
 
Общая образованность низка, так что программисты ручные всегда нужны будут. Даже этот ии, насколько много людей за 40+ только вотсап освоили, а бизнес открывать люди будут разные, и под их задачи всегда будет находится персонал. Ну а если речь идёт о больших кампаниях, то я тут ничего сказать не могу, мало знаю за гугл, майкрософт и тд, могу сказать только то, что они с лёгкостью сокращают рабочие места и борются за создание ии, хотя пока на этот ии не плохой такой цензурный колпак надевают. Например ИИ, даже из первого Дэна уверен, что Бог существует, а также капиталистические утверждение впаривает, не желая говорить о них минусы, например пустышки для детей...
 
скорее всего не заменят, программисты все также будут нужны. AI повлияют на скорость написания кода, что только поможет кодеру быстрее выполнять свою работу, инструмент же. сомневаюсь что AI автоматизируют до уровня живого человека который работает программистом, и, тем более, делает все за день до дедлайна))
 
AI заменит кодеров с тенденцией его развития, лет так через 5, так что уже пора подумать о роде своих будущих занятий, например разгребателя созданного ИИ немеряного кода ))
 
Когда в крупных компаниях от момента дизайна до момента выхода фичи в прод проходит от 3 до бесконечности месяцев, и простой на сутки стоит 1кк$ из за бага, с учетом 3 уровней тестирования, а\б тестирования и прочих штук, которые должны от этого бага уберечь.
Никогда не поверю что кто-то в здравом уме согласится пихать в прод написанное непонятно кем или чем нечто в котором а) никто не разберется с наскока что-где-когда б) никто не возьмет на себя ответственность за это.
Мелкие конторы, которые клепают сайтецы для домохозяек и торгашей с рынка за оверпрайс - да, скорее всего переквалифицируются в конторы "менеджеров ИИ", которые дрочат бота до тех пор пока он не выдаст им что-то похожее на правду и что можно быстро впарить. Энтерпрайз на такое ближайшие лет 20-30 точно не пойдет.
 
которые дрочат бота до тех пор пока он не выдаст им что-то похожее на правду
:) Поугарал... Вовсе не 20 -30 лет, а пару -тройку. Ты видишь же что все в геометрической прогрессии прогрессирует, тут уже закон Мура лесом проходит. вот GPT на свободу выпустили, чем кончится -посмотрим.
 
За пару-тройку в отношении галер соглашусь, но там где крутятся нормальные деньги и люди умеют считать - 4 года ушло только на то чтобы условную версию фреймворка поднять не для минорных фиксов.
И этим занимался не один человек, а отдельная команда на 50 человек в общей сумме.
Не в жизнь не поверю что такую задачу дадут на откуп ИИ и скормят ему кодовую базу за 5-10-15 лет. Мало того непонятно куда этот код утечет дальше и что делать когда он где-то всплывет.
Да на месте желающий войти-в-айти я бы задумался о плане Б так как скорее всего галеры снизят рейт еще больше. А вот тем у кого уровень синьор-помидор и выше я думаю на этот век работы хватит, а там как говорится хоть трава не расти.
 
:) Поугарал... Вовсе не 20 -30 лет, а пару -тройку. Ты видишь же что все в геометрической прогрессии прогрессирует, тут уже закон Мура лесом проходит. вот GPT на свободу выпустили, чем кончится -посмотрим.
Просто надо заставить самую прогрессивную нейросеть прогрессировать в геометрической прогрессии, ex.: в задачу ей поставить создание улучшенной версии себя самой, и созданной таким образом нейросетке след. поколения - поставить такую же задачу, и т.д. - в бесконечный цикл. Она же самообучаема, вот пусть учится учитывать свои недостатки и улучшать свои алгоритмы на этой основе. Кодеры просто не догадались, всё разрабатывают и шлифуют ChatGPT v 4, а тут делов то на пару недель, какие пару тройку лет, епта. :D Жалким людишкам только и останется железо апгрейдить, да? Ведь так же? :D
 


Напишите ответ...
  • Вставить:
Прикрепить файлы
Верх